Woman Burns to Death Trying to Light Propane Stove

From Times Wire Services

A 66-year-old woman was burned to death when her clothing caught on fire as she lit a propane stove in the kitchen of her mobile home near Palmdale, authorities said Sunday.

The woman, whose name was not released, had gone into the kitchen of her mobile home at 9203 E. Avenue S in the Little Rock area at about 6:50 a.m. Saturday, Los Angeles County firefighter Bob Goldman said.

The flames apparently caught some of her loose clothing on fire and she fell back onto the floor, where she burned to death, Goldman said.

The fire also ignited some kitchen cabinets, he said.

The woman’s husband awoke to the smell of smoke but couldn’t find her, so he fled the trailer and called firefighters, Goldman said.

Firefighters extinguished the flames and found the woman’s body in the kitchen, he said.

Damage to the trailer was estimated at $500.
